duff 0 Report post Posted September 21, 2008 I've just upgraded both tmg and gensmarts to the most recent versions. Installations went fine, but when I try to restore and open my tmg file in tmg, it does the restore fully, then the whole metering progress of opening the file, right up to "Checking...1/8 names", and mostly through that, when I get the following error(s) in tmg: Memo file C:\...\tmg\tmgfilename_g.fpt is missing or invalid. 137 FIX_52 ignore gets same mess with 138 FIX_52 ignore that gets 139 FIX_52 Then the meter continues until it errors again in that same sequence of 3 numbers, infinitely.which ignoring then will not sway the meter. Abort is then the only choice, after which the file opens. I saw a previous post with a similar but different error, where the admin recommended go back to original file in tmg6...optimize, validate, reoptimize...no compression for backup....did all that....hours...over several days. no luck. same problem. What next? The prior post to which I referred also suggested that admin might be able to tweak something else in the file if it is a very large file, which it is. May I try that, or have you any other possible solutions? Both TMG & GenSmarts worked great, together or standalone, on the previous versions that I had.
